概括
诊断骨和软组织瘤的放射学错误可能导致错误的治疗方法. 本综述强调了常见的错误和成像特征,以提高这些关键条件的诊断准确度.

背景情况:
- 准确诊断骨和软组织瘤对于患者管理至关重要.
- 放射学错误是一个重大挑战,可能导致不适当的干预或治疗延迟.
研究的目的:
- 描述在评估骨和软组织瘤中的常见放射学错误.
- 专注于成像功能,帮助区分良性和恶性病变.
- 要突出成像在区分某些瘤的局限性.
主要方法:
- 在骨和软组织瘤评估中常见的放射学错误的审查.
- 对成像特征的分析,以区分良性病变和恶性病变.
- 讨论临床和组织病理学数据的整合.
主要成果:
- 常见的错误包括错误描述病变行为 (良性与恶性) 和过度依赖单一的成像模式.
- 无法整合临床和组织病理学数据是一个关键的诊断陷.
- 特定的成像特征可以帮助区分病变类型,但存在限制.
结论:
- 改善骨和软组织瘤的诊断准确性需要了解常见的放射学错误.
- 仔细整合成像检测结果与临床和组织病理学数据至关重要.
- 承认仅仅是成像的局限性对于适当的患者管理至关重要.

Blood and Nerve Supply to the Bones
13.5K
Bones are dynamic organs that require a rich supply of oxygen and nutrients. Around 5% to 10% of the cardiac output supplies blood to the bones. A typical long bone has three main sources: the nutrient artery, the metaphyseal and epiphyseal arteries, and the periosteal arteries.
